ASPI USA was proud to have Dr. Nishank Motwani moderate a roundtable discussion with Microsoft’s Dr. Ethan Jackson on biosecurity in the Pacific Islands and the positive role AI can play in advancing regional resilience.
The event brought together Microsoft engineers, Pacific Island representatives, U.S. government officials, and leading academics to explore how advanced AI systems could support the region, while also addressing local concerns around digital infrastructure, resource limitations, and environmental constraints.
Innovative technologies like Microsoft’s Premonition, which can detect species interactions and flag potential threats using AI, highlight the power of these tools in safeguarding fragile ecosystems. Ensuring that these solutions are designed with local context in mind is key to building a more secure, sustainable, and interconnected Pacific.
